BBA (2ND Semester) Decision Making Techniques [Assignment-1]

Note: Attempt all 10 questions. Each question carries equal marks. [10 × 5 = 50 Marks]

Q.1. An incomplete frequency distribution is given as follows:

Variable: 0-10 10-20 20-30 30-40 40-50 50-60 60-70 Total

Freq.: 10 10 ? ? ? 6 4 230

Given that the median value is 33.5 and mode is 34, determine the missing frequencies.

Q.2. (a) Differentiate between primary and secondary data.

(B) Differentiate between Bar graph and Histogram.

Q.3. Describe the characteristics of good measure of dispersion. Comment on the best measure of
dispersion and also write its merits and demerits.

Q.4. Calculate median, mean deviation about median from the following data:

Marks: 0-10 10-20 20-30 30-40 40-50 50-60 60-70

No. of Students: 6 5 8 15 7 6 3

Q.5. Calculate mean and standard deviation for the following table giving the age distribution of 542
members:

Age: 20-30 30-40 40-50 50-60 60-70 70-80 80-90

No. of Students: 3 61 132 153 140 51 2

Q.6. Calculate correlation coeff for the table given below:

Heights of Father(inches): 65 66 67 67 68 69 70 72

Heights of Son(inches): 67 68 65 68 72 72 61 71

Q.7. Calculate rank coeff of correlation between advertisement cost and sales from the following
data:

Advertisement Cost 39 65 62 90 82 75 25 98 36 78
(‘000Rs): 47 53 58 86 62 68 60 91 51 84
Sales (Lakhs):

Q.8. (a) Correlation is not a causation. Comment.

(b) Differentiate between Correlation and Regression.

Q.9. Two regression lines are given as:

4x - 5y + 33 = 0 and 20x – 9y – 107 = 0


And variance of X = 9, find

(1) Mean values of X, Y


(2) byx and bxy
(3) Coeff. of determination
(4) Standard deviation of Y.

Q.10. Given the following values of X and Y,

X:
12 18 32 18 25 24 25 40 38 22
Y: 16 15 28 16 24 22 28 36 34 19

Find regression lines X on Y and Y on X. Also estimate X, when Y = 40 and estimate Y when X is 42.
